SSOT health has three aspects; Secured Pharma, Secured EMR, Secured claims. Some of the features of secured Pharma includes

Keeping all personal medical records up to date.

Integrated with any medical system operates on Blockchain. 

Authorization by the users discretion.

Granularity of the access level are defined by the patients.
 
Blockchain enabled SSOT-ID creates SecuredPHR user accounts.

You can check out their website for other other features.

I understand that SSOT project is about health/medicine but what i don't seem to understand is the relationship it has got to do with Insurance company  Huh is it like the patient is insured by SSOT and their is a separate smart contract for that as seen here https://www.ssothealth.org/solutions  Huh

To my knowledge its basically allowing for a secure method and traceable healthcare for your claims. In the end how do you know what claims your doctor are sending to insurance on your behalf? Insurance fraud is pretty huge, by moving that to a public blickchain and ledger it means you can whenever you want view all your issues, historal claims etc, and your basically in charge of your medical records. I don't know about where you live but i honestly have never seen my medical record, my doctor has it in a cabinet but i don't really get to see it, i can fill out a claim for insurance but basically the only way they know it was me is a signature, technically he could forge my signature and claim whatever he wanted against my insurance as if he treated me.
